After the G20 Summit is overtaken by terrorists, President Danielle Sutton must bring all her statecraft and military experience to defend her family and her fellow leaders.
Release Date: Apr 10, 2025
Director: Patricia Riggen
Writer: Caitlin Parrish, Noah Miller, Erica Weiss, Logan Miller
Genres: Action, Drama, Mystery
